Publication Lea (1860): summary
     publication summary

Complete Citation

Lea, I. 1860. Descriptions of four new species of Unionidæ from Brazil and Buenos Ayres. Proceedings of the Academy of Natural Sciences of Philadelphia 12: 89-90. Available electronically.

Attributed Nominal Species

Anodonta amazonensis Lea, 1860
Lea, 1860. Proc. Acad. Nat. Sci. 12: 89.
Lea, 1863. Jour. Acad. Nat. Sci. 5 [O. 10]: 395 [31], pl. 46, fig. 300.
Type(s): HOLOTYPE USNM_86724, Upper Amazon, Brazil.

Anodonta moricandii Lea, 1860
Lea, 1860. Proc. Acad. Nat. Sci. 12: 90.
Lea, 1863. Jour. Acad. Nat. Sci. 5 [O. 10]: 396, pl. 49, fig. 303.
Type(s): HOLOTYPE USNM_86695, Bahia, Brazil.

Unio patelloides Lea, 1860
Lea, 1860. Proc. Acad. Nat. Sci. 12: 89.
Lea, 1863. Jour. Acad. Nat. Sci. 5 [O. 10]: 383 [19], pl. 43, fig. 291.
Type(s): HOLOTYPE USNM_85780, Amazon R., Brazil.

Unio trifidus Lea, 1860
Lea, 1860. Proc. Acad. Nat. Sci. 12: 89.
Lea, 1863. Jour. Acad. Nat. Sci. 5 [O. 10]: 386 [22], pl. 54, fig. 295.
Type(s): HOLOTYPE USNM_85352, Buenos Ayres, Argentina.
